Description: | During the period in question, the Doppler lidar's scan schedule was modified temporarily
to support a small IOP at the SGP central facility. This change effects data acquired
after about 22:00 UTC on 20130627. Normal operations were resumed at about 2330 on 3 July
2013. The modified scan schedule resulted in the generation of sgpdlusrC1.b1 data files.
Each of these files contain a series of stares at several different elevation angles.
These scans were designed to measure turbulent statistics at several heights directly above
another nearby Doppler lidar system (LLNL's WindCube V2). A third Doppler lidar system
(OU's Streamline) performed coordinated and simultaneous stares over the WindCube. The goal
of these measurements is to retrieve three-dimensional turbulent statistics as a function
of height above the WindCube. For more information contact Dr. Petra Kline at the
University of Oklahoma. |
